Sushi Bake: Indulgent Delight with Turkey Bacon and Chicken Ham

A delicious and indulgent sushi bake that combines the flavors of turkey bacon and chicken ham.

- Prep Time: 15 minutes
- Cook Time: 25 minutes
- Total Time: 40 minutes
- Yield: 4 servings

- 2 cups sushi rice
- 3 cups water
- 1/2 cup rice vinegar
- 1/4 cup sugar
- 1 teaspoon salt
- 4 slices turkey bacon
- 1 cup chicken ham, diced
- 1/2 cup mayonnaise
- 2 tablespoons sriracha sauce
- 1/4 cup green onions, chopped
- 1 sheet nori, cut into strips
- 1 tablespoon sesame seeds
-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C).
- In a saucepan, combine sushi rice and water. Cook until rice is tender.
- Mix rice vinegar, sugar, and salt in a small bowl until dissolved, then stir into the cooked rice.
- In a skillet, cook the turkey bacon until crispy, then crumble it.
- In a mixing bowl, combine the cooked rice, chicken ham, mayonnaise, sriracha sauce, green onions, and turkey bacon.
- Spread the mixture evenly in a baking dish and top with nori strips and sesame seeds.
- Bake in the preheated oven for 20 minutes until heated through and slightly crispy on top.
Notes
- Feel free to adjust the sriracha to taste for desired spiciness.
- Can substitute chicken ham with any preferred cooked meat.
